Algorithm_bresenham (x 1, y 1, x 2, y 2) { x= x 1; These operations can be performed very rapidly so. A detailed explanation of the algorithm can be found or. Web bresenham line algorithm is a optimistic & incremental scan conversion line drawing algorithm which calculates all intermediate points over the interval between start and end points, implemented entirely with integer numbers and the integer arithmetic. For example, in a horizontal line, there is no need to perform any vertical.
Y = mx + b y d1 d2. Line endpoints at (x1,y1) and (x2, y2) x1 < x2 line slope ≤ 45o, i.e. Web bresenham’s line generation algorithm. This algorithm is named after bresenham.
Web this version limited to slopes in the first octant,. While (x <= x 2) { putpixel (x,y); You can however produce faster algorithms by using specific line routines.
PPT Line Drawing Algorithms Bresenham PowerPoint Presentation
Web computer graphics use three different types of algorithms to generate lines namely: It was developed by jack e. P = 2dx = dy; Y = mx + b. Web this algorithm is used for scan converting a line.
We provide the mathematical description and the pseudocode of the algorithm. Is a way of drawing a line segment onto a square grid. These operations can be performed very rapidly so.
Sokolov Edited This Page On Mar 21, 2021 · 19 Revisions.
The algorithm calculates which pixels to color in order to create a straight line between two points. Is a way of drawing a line segment onto a square grid. Web the bresenham line drawing algorithm provides a very efficient way to plot a straight line between two points on a bitmap image (such as an lcd screen). This algorithm provides the means for the fast and efficient way to represent continuous abstract lines onto discrete plane of computer display.
Y = Mx + B.
Algorithm_bresenham (x 1, y 1, x 2, y 2) { x= x 1; The task is to find all the intermediate points required for drawing line ab on the computer screen of pixels. Web this version limited to slopes in the first octant,. Web bresenham’s line generation algorithm.
This Process Is Called Rasterization.
For example, in a horizontal line, there is no need to perform any vertical. These operations can be performed very rapidly so. Web this algorithm plots lines, circles, ellipses, bézier curves and more. Void linebresenham(int x0, int y0, int x1, int y1) { int dx, dy;
This Algorithm Is Named After Bresenham.
The bresenham line drawing algorithm given below is for the slope value less than one that is as follows: It is an efficient method because it involves only integer addition, subtractions, and multiplication operations. A detailed explanation of the algorithm can be found or. Web bresenham line algorithm is a optimistic & incremental scan conversion line drawing algorithm which calculates all intermediate points over the interval between start and end points, implemented entirely with integer numbers and the integer arithmetic.
Web the bresenham line drawing algorithm takes four integer values that are x 1, y 1, x 2, and y 2. For ( int x = x1; This post explains why this is, how the algorithm works, and a variation that you might prefer to use. Finally, we show a numerical example. 1) dda line drawing algorithm 2) bresenham line drawing algorithm 3) mid point line drawing algorithm this video focuses on the bresenham line drawing algorithm.